Subject: Transcode farm cut-over — done!

Hey Marek,

We flipped the Vexelform transcoding farm over to the new scheduler last night. Zero dropped jobs, and the H.265 queue drained faster than on the old Quillhaven cluster. Worker autoscaling kicked in twice, both times cleanly. Only hiccup: one stale node kept polling the retired endpoint until we rebooted it. Please sanity-check the settings before I tag the release. Here's the full config the farm booted with:

config for yajep-tafof:
[rusath]
team = julmir
access_code = ac_fe37fd
host = rusath.novactech.test
port = 8000
owner = pelmir.weneth
peer = oliwyn.olvarqdyn.internal

## Tuning the Almswick receipt mailer

The Almswick mailer batches donation receipts and dispatches them through the outbound queue. Plugin authors who add custom templates should be aware that rendering happens inside the batch loop, so slow templates shrink effective throughput. Rate limits exist to keep the upstream relay from throttling us; do not raise them in plugin code. The batching and retry constants the mailer ships with are these.

limits module of kawef-hawef:
TIERS = {
    "belax": 967,
    "gorvan": 210,
    "ulair": 473,
}

Runbook 12.3 — ThumbCache memory leak mitigation. The leak in Greyhollow's ThumbCache worker grows under sustained resize traffic; the interim fix enables periodic heap snapshots shipped to the internal profiler. Snapshots may contain request paths, so access is restricted. Set HEAP_SNAP_INTERVAL=900 and SNAP_RETENTION=7 in /etc/thumbcache/worker.env. The profiler upload endpoint requires an authenticated write credential, reviewed under policy SEC-88. Append that credential line immediately below this sentence.

secret setting of yagef-baweg: RELAY_SECRET29=cb53deb59a49ed54d9f43599b54ca